LibreOffice Module unotools (master) 1
Public Member Functions | Private Attributes | List of all members
CollatorWrapper Class Reference

#include <collatorwrapper.hxx>

Public Member Functions

 CollatorWrapper (const css::uno::Reference< css::uno::XComponentContext > &rxContext)
 
sal_Int32 compareString (const OUString &s1, const OUString &s2) const
 
css::uno::Sequence< OUString > listCollatorAlgorithms (const css::lang::Locale &rLocale) const
 
sal_Int32 loadDefaultCollator (const css::lang::Locale &rLocale, sal_Int32 nOption)
 
void loadCollatorAlgorithm (const OUString &rAlgorithm, const css::lang::Locale &rLocale, sal_Int32 nOption)
 

Private Attributes

css::uno::Reference< css::i18n::XCollator > mxInternationalCollator
 

Detailed Description

Definition at line 34 of file collatorwrapper.hxx.

Constructor & Destructor Documentation

◆ CollatorWrapper()

CollatorWrapper::CollatorWrapper ( const css::uno::Reference< css::uno::XComponentContext > &  rxContext)

Definition at line 28 of file collatorwrapper.cxx.

References mxInternationalCollator.

Member Function Documentation

◆ compareString()

sal_Int32 CollatorWrapper::compareString ( const OUString &  s1,
const OUString &  s2 
) const

Definition at line 34 of file collatorwrapper.cxx.

References mxInternationalCollator, and SAL_WARN.

◆ listCollatorAlgorithms()

uno::Sequence< OUString > CollatorWrapper::listCollatorAlgorithms ( const css::lang::Locale &  rLocale) const

Definition at line 50 of file collatorwrapper.cxx.

References mxInternationalCollator, and SAL_WARN.

◆ loadCollatorAlgorithm()

void CollatorWrapper::loadCollatorAlgorithm ( const OUString &  rAlgorithm,
const css::lang::Locale &  rLocale,
sal_Int32  nOption 
)

Definition at line 82 of file collatorwrapper.cxx.

References mxInternationalCollator, and SAL_WARN.

◆ loadDefaultCollator()

sal_Int32 CollatorWrapper::loadDefaultCollator ( const css::lang::Locale &  rLocale,
sal_Int32  nOption 
)

Definition at line 66 of file collatorwrapper.cxx.

References mxInternationalCollator, and SAL_WARN.

Member Data Documentation

◆ mxInternationalCollator

css::uno::Reference< css::i18n::XCollator > CollatorWrapper::mxInternationalCollator
private

The documentation for this class was generated from the following files: